
cis-Pellitorin is a pungent flavoring agent isolated from the tarragon plant (Artemisia dracunculus L.). It is used to give a prickly, “hot” taste to foods and oral hygiene products. A new synthesis of cis-pellitorin is described in Patent Watch for March 9, 2009.
